Becoming a holistic nutritionist

Holistic healing involves natural and non-invasive practices to move the body into its highest level of health. Of course, the most natural means of achieving health is through balanced nutritional programs and principles.

There are a number of schools that take the holistic approach in their nutrition degree program. It is also possible to earn a nutrition degree online. Once you have the degree, there are nutrition jobs in areas such as health care facilities, school nutrition programs, health clubs and even corporate cafeterias.

According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, the job market in this area will continue growing because of the increasing emphasis on disease prevention through improved dietary habits. Their studies show the growth continuing for at least another decade.
